Operate a Counterbalance Forklift.
-
Responsible for all loading/unloading of plant.
-
Prepare, maintain and clean equipment, using a pressure washer where required.
-
Check that orders are correct before dispatch to a customer.
-
Ensure plant is stored and stacked correctly and safely.
-
Complete and record required equipment checks/inspections both periodically and prior to dispatch.
-
Accurate recording of both inward/outward stock movements on a daily basis.
-
Inspect equipment for any damage in accordance with our quality control standards.
-
Complete accurate stock checks as directed, reporting any discrepancies direct to the Depot Operations Manager.
-
Observe general yard/workshop discipline, promoting a high standard of behaviour and an adaptable approach to tasks allocated.
-
Maintain clean, tidy and safe working area(s), ensuring all equipment and consumables are stored in the appropriate manner.
-
Previous experience in a yard or warehouse environment.
-
Counterbalance Forklift – current valid license highly desirable but not essential.
-
Ability to work in a fast-paced environment, with a focus on safety and efficiency
-
Physically able to lift and manoeuvre heavy objects.
Working conditions…
-
The role is based in a busy yard environment, with regular exposure to the outdoors.
-
The role requires frequent lifting, bending and manual handling.
-
The role may involve working at heights, using ladders and stairs.
